Hailing from Wigan in the North West of England (UK), Deepshade are steadily
gaining recognition for their formidable and uncompromising grungey
alternative-psych rock identity that draws from the fundamental elements of
influential artists such as Nirvana, Queens Of The Stone Age, Led Zeppelin,
Black Sabbath whilst incorporating aspects of The Doors, Soundgarden , Pink
Floyd amongst many many others. Forming in late 2013 by David Rybka
(Vox/Guitar), Tom Doherty (Bass) and Paul Barlow (Drums) the eclectic trio
mutually aspired to create a genuinely sonic experience that delivers
something fresh to the British music scene. With an established following
throughout England’s northern territories, cultivated by a flurry of
explosive live shows, Deepshade were brought to a wider audiences through
airplay support from BBC Introducing and a plethora of alternative radio
stations within the UK, Europe and USA. Despite the band still being
relatively in its creative infancy, Deepshade were soon to be recognised by
the broadsheet publication ‘The Guardian’ as one of the ‘Hot Top Ten
Unsigned British Bands To Check Out’. The off-kilter rockers soon after
progressed things further by signing with independent UK label/management
Ambicon Music Group. In early 2015 the band unearthed the potent and free
download single ‘Tattoo’ from their soon to be released debut album.
Premiering on Krank TV and enabling the band to secure expose from rock
media platforms around the globe, Tattoo delivered a calling-card from
Deepshade that they had firmly arrived on the planet with some serious
potential. Leading on from the release their ‘The Line’ video single, the
eagerly awaited ‘Everything Popular Is Wrong’ was released in Sept 2015 via
Ambicon Records.
Recorded with producer John Kettle and mastered by Fran Ashcroft, the album
features 10 colossal tracks that are a call to arms for music lovers who are
absorbed by gritty rock akin to Kyuss and Led Zeppelin. From the opening
snarling riff attack of ‘Time’ to the infectious and angular assault of ‘Sad
Sun’ – the album shouted out to the world that the trio were capable of
tastefully flirting with the margins of everything from post-grunge to
stoner rock to 60s psychedelic to heavy metal. Drawing attention from
mainstream rock publications – Everything Popular Is Wrong’ earned positive
attention from PowerPlay and Classic Rock Magazine. The latter featuring
‘Sad Sun’ on their cover mount ‘Rock Revival’ compilation CD.
With drummer Paul Barlow departing on amicable terms the band forged on,
Deepshade welcomed their new ally and now full-time member Chris Oldfield
into the fold. Along side the many years of actively gigging around the UK
venue circuit, Deepshade have a number of festival appearances under their
belt, including Psychedelic/Space Summer Rock Solstice and Rockmantic
Weekender. Commencing the process of writing and recording a new album,
again with producer John Kettle – Deepshade have evolved as a unit and push
the boundaries of their own sound. Adding another sonic angle to the new
songs with the addition of Francis Lydiate on Keys in the studio as well as
Mr Rybka playing some too.
Deepshade proclaim that there new album is delving deeper into heavier
psych-rock dimensions. As 2019 unfolds Deepshade have now joined the roster
of the behemoth rock/metal specialist label ‘WormholeDeath Records (Italy)
and are ecstatic at making a new record in 2020 .
‘Soul Divider’ was released on 21 June 2019 via Wormholedeath / The Orchard
/ Wormholedeath USA
